Alphonse Gabriel Capone, notoriously in order to "Scarface," ruled the streets of Chicago for over a decade (1919 - 1930) During these years, Capone rose to power through any means necessary, including but was not limited to: bootlegging, gambling, prostitution, assault, theft, arson, and murder. When Elliot Ness brought down Capone in 1930, the authorities did donrrrt you have enough evidence to charge him with any of the above incidents. However, it is understandable that the most famous Gagster in American History was arrested and jailed solely for income tax evasion.
The government is a potent force. In spite of the best efforts of agents, they could never nail Capone for murder, violating prohibition or some other charge directly related to his conduct. Basically, the irs recognizes that income earned abroad is taxed together with resident country, and may be excluded from taxable income the particular IRS in the event the proper forms are registered. The source of the income salary paid for earned income has no bearing on whether end up being U.S. or foreign earned income, but rather where operate or services are performed (as the actual example of employee doing work for the U.S. subsidiary abroad, and receiving his salary from parents U.S. company out within the U.S.).
